Understanding The Calendar System

Brief Introduction To The Gregorian Calendar System

The gregorian calendar system is the most widely used calendar globally. It is a solar calendar that was introduced by pope gregory xiii in 1582 to replace the julian calendar. The gregorian calendar has 365 days in a regular year and 366 days in a leap year.

It is named after pope gregory xiii, who declared it a reform of the julian calendar.

Overview Of How The Calendar Is Structured

The gregorian calendar is structured in a way that there are 12 months in a year. Each month has either 30 or 31 days, except for february, which has 28 days (and 29 during leap years). The 12 months of the year and their respective number of days are:

  • January (31 days)
  • February (28 days, or 29 in leap years)
  • March (31 days)
  • April (30 days)
  • May (31 days)
  • June (30 days)
  • July (31 days)
  • August (31 days)
  • September (30 days)
  • October (31 days)
  • November (30 days)
  • December (31 days)

Explanation Of Leap Years And Their Significance

A leap year occurs every four years to account for the fact that the earth takes approximately 365. 2422 days to orbit the sun. Without a leap year, the calendar would drift out of sync with the seasons. During a leap year, an extra day, february 29th, is added to the calendar, making that year 366 days long.

The exception to this rule is that years ending in “00” are not leap years, unless they are divisible by 400. This means that the year 2000 was a leap year, but 1900 was not.
